// Client setup for the Brindlewick nightly reindex.
// Plugin authors: do not trigger reindex outside the 02:00 window.
// The Searchtide client below talks to the internal indexer only;
// public queries go through the gateway instead.
// Auth uses a scoped key for the indexer service, shown below.

app token of yajof-fajof = zpat11_OrsDd3gqCaG

Subject: Warranty costs — heads up

Team, warranty spend on the Drossel 9 line came in 30% over plan, mostly hinge failures from the Varnholt batch. Supplier's accepted partial liability; Ines is negotiating recovery. We've paused shipments from that lot. Before the board meets, the plan we're working toward is below.

confidential, bahap-bajog: Zorethix Works is in early talks to buy Kelethox Foods for about $30.7 million. The Ralvan launch date is September 19, and nothing goes to the press before then.

## Webhook Retry Semantics (Quillhook Dispatcher)

Deliveries retry on any 5xx, connection reset, or timeout, using exponential backoff with full jitter. 4xx responses other than 429 are terminal and move the event to the dead-letter table. A 429 honors any server-supplied retry hint, capped at the maximum interval. Retries stop after the attempt limit or the age ceiling, whichever comes first; both are tuned per tenant tier. The defaults the dispatcher ships with are listed below:

service settings:
PRAIX_LOG_LEVEL=error
PRAIX_METRICS_HOST=metrics.praix.qorvelcorp.corp
PRAIX_POOL_SIZE=16